Wheaton Springs at WheatonArts
Celebrate the start of Wheaton Arts and Cultural Center's creative season with the free kick-off event Wheaton Springs 2025 from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. on Saturday, April 5! The Wheaton Springs 2025 event offers visitors of all ages the chance to explore, experience, create, and celebrate across WheatonArts' 45-acre campus that inspires creativity. Admission to all exhibitions and artist studio demonstrations is free and open to the public, part of WheatonArts Family Days, presented by PNC Arts Alive!
Explore Transformations: The Wasserstein Collection of Contemporary Glass and redundancies curated by David Schnuckel in the Museum of American Glass and Communities and Cultures of Down Jersey in the Down Jersey Folklife Center on display April through December. Experience a collection of artist demonstrations throughout the campus and take a kiln tour in the Pottery Studio! Create a series of hands-on projects for all ages and skill levels with our spring themed Family Art Activities! Celebrate with food, shopping, and a walk around the Nature Trail!
